.r {
color: #183A48;
font-weight: bold;
text-decoration: underline;
}

a.r:link {
}

a.r:visited {
/*color: #7576A3;*/
}

a.r:hover {
color: #DF0303;
}

.bluelink {
color: #FFFFFF;
font-weight: bold;
text-decoration: underline;
}

a.bluelink:link {
}

a.bluelink:visited {
/*color: #7576A3;*/
}

a.bluelink:hover {
color: #DF0303;
}

.programlink {
font-size: 11px;
color: #000000;
font-weight: bold;
text-decoration: underline;
}

a.programlink:link {
}

a.programlink:visited {
color: #2F5767;
}

a.programlink:hover {
color: #DF0303;
}

.programlink1 {
/*border: 4px solid gray;*/
padding: 6px;
font-size: 18px;
color: #000000;
font-weight: bold;
text-decoration: underline;
}

a.programlink1:link {
}

a.programlink1:visited {
color: #2F5767;
}

a.programlink1:hover {
color: #3300AA;
color: #006400;
}

body {
background: #183A48;
/*background: #BDB7A7 url(images/bg.jpg) repeat-x fixed top;*/
/*background: #BDB7A7*/
font-family: Arial, Verdana, Arial, Helvetica, sans-serif;
font-size: 13px;
font-weight: bold;
}

.bigsmallcaps {
font-variant: small-caps;
font-size: 18px;
font-weight: bold;
color: #183A48;
}

.biggersmallcaps {
font-variant: small-caps;
font-size: 24px;
font-weight: bold;
/*color: #183A48;*/
color: #800000;
}

.bolder {
color: #800000;
font-variant: small-caps;
font-size: 15px;
font-weight: bold;
}

.bolderyet {
color: #550101;
font-variant: small-caps;
font-size: 18px;
font-weight: bold;
}

.bigsmallcapsyellow {
font-variant: small-caps;
font-size: 18px;
font-weight: bold;
color: yellow;
}

.edge {
width: 40px;
background-color: #183A48;
}

.ledge {
width: 40px;
background-color: #93CCCD;
}

.manhdr {
background: #C0C0FF;
color: black;
font-size: 16px;
font-weight: bold;
text-align: center;
}

.menu {
font-size: 13px;
text-align: center;
color: #000000;
}

a.menu:link {
color: #000000;
text-decoration: none;
}

a.menu:visited {
color: #000000;
text-decoration: none;
}

a.menu:hover {
color: #028EC8;
text-decoration: underline;
}

.menuwhite {
font-size: 14px;
text-align: center;
font-weight: bold;
color: #FFFFFF;
}

a.menuwhite:link {
color: #FFFFFF;
text-decoration: none;
}

a.menuwhite:visited {
color: #FFFFFF;
text-decoration: none;
}

a.menuwhite:hover {
color: #00FFFF;
/*color: #028EC8;*/
text-decoration: underline;
}

.nava2 {
font-size: 12px;
text-indent: 10px;
}

.reglink {
color: #183A48;
font-weight: bold;
}

a.reglink:link {
}

a.reglink:visited {
}

a.reglink:hover {
color: #DF0303;
text-decoration: underline;
}

.shaded {
background-color: #C5C5B9;
}

.normal {
font-size: 13px;
font-weight: bold;
}

.progname {
background-color: #224672;
/*background-color: #95ACC5;*/
/*background-color: #202020;*/
/*color: black;*/
color: white;
font-size: 13px;
font-weight: bold;
text-decoration: underline;

/*border-bottom: 3 solid #224672;*/
border-bottom: 3 solid black;
text-align: center;

}

.progname:link {
color: white;
}

a.progname:visited {
/*color: #7576A3;*/
}

a.progname:hover {
color: #DF0303;
}

a.progname:active {
color: #DF0303;
}

.feature {
width: 34%;
background-color: #AB7100;
background-color: #D2B27A;
color: black;
font-size: 11px;
font-weight: bold;
text-decoration: none;

border-bottom: 3 solid #AB7100;
width: 50%;

}

.benefit {
width: 34%;
background-color: #567C46;
background-color: #95B688;
color: black;
font-size: 11px;
font-weight: bold;
text-decoration: none;

border-bottom: 3 solid #567C46;
width: 50%;

}

.normalwhite {
font-size: 13px;
font-weight: bold;
color: #FFFFFF;
}

strong {
background: #008000;
}

.big3 {
font-size: 20px;
color: #FFFFFF
}

.small1 {
font-size: 12px;
color: black;
position: relative;
top: 10px;
left: 10px;
}

.calendar {
color: #FFFFFF;
font-weight: bold;
text-align: center;
}

.greenhighlight {
color: white;
background: #008000;
}
